What are Open World Games?

Open world games provide players with an immersive experience within a large virtual environment. Players can roam freely, engage in quests, build their characters, and influence the game world’s dynamics. The key feature of open world games is the freedom they grant; players can choose how to approach challenges and interact with the environment.

Characteristics of Open World Games

  • Exploration: Players can traverse vast landscapes, discovering new areas and uncovering hidden treasures.
  • Non-Linear Gameplay: Unlike linear games, players determine their path and can opt to complete missions in any order.
  • Quest Variety: From main story missions to side quests, there’s a wealth of activities available.
  • Dynamic Environment: Weather changes, day-night cycles, and NPC interactions add depth to gameplay.

The Best Open World Simulation Games

1. The Sims 4

One of the most iconic life simulation games, The Sims 4 allows players to create and control virtual people. From building homes to developing relationships, the freedom in gameplay is vast.

2. Grand Theft Auto V (GTA V)

This title isn’t just about crime; it provides an expansive open world where players can engage in various simulation activities from car racing to sports events.

3. Stardew Valley

As a farming simulation game, Stardew Valley combines farming with role-playing elements. Players can cultivate crops, raise animals, and build relationships with townsfolk, all while exploring their surroundings.

4. Cities: Skylines

This city-building simulation encourages players to design and manage a city. The open world nature allows for creative urban planning and development.

The Role of Mods in Open World Games

Mods significantly enhance open-world games. They can introduce new gameplay mechanics, enhance graphics, and fix bugs. Communities around games like The Sims 4 and GTA V have produced mods that expand gameplay options, which in turn boosts player retention.

Challenges of Open World Game Design

Despite their popularity, developing open-world games comes with challenges. **Balancing quests** to ensure they feel rewarding while maintaining an engaging world can be difficult. Moreover, avoiding repetitive gameplay and ensuring the environment remains challenging is essential.
